SWITCH CASE ஆனது MULTIWAY BRANCH கட்டளை ஆகும். IF-ELSE IF LADDER –க்கு பதிலாக பயன் படுத்தப்படுகின்றது.
SYNTAX:
இதில் VALUE1 ,VALUE2 என்பது INT,CHAR,SHORT,BYTE இவற்றில் ஏதாவது
ஒன்றாக இருக்கலாம்.JDK 7-லிருந்து STRING டேட்டாவும் அனுமதிக்கப்படுகின்றது. CASE VALUE ஆனது SWITCH –ல் உள்ள EXPRESSION உடன் COMPARE செய்யப் படுகின்றது.
இரண்டும் ஒரே
மதிப்பாக இருக்கும் பட்சத்தில் அந்த STATEMENT SEQUENCE இயக்கப்படுகின்றது. எதுவுமே MATCH ஆகவில்லை என்றால் DEFAULT STATEMENT
SEQUENCE இயக்கப்படுகின்றது.
உதாரணம்
OUTPUT:
BREAK STATEMENT ஆனது அந்தந்த STATEMENT SEQUENCE இயக்கப்பட்டவுடன் SWITCH CASE STRUCTURE-ஐ
விட்டு வெளியேற பயன்படுகின்றது.
FOR LOOP VARIATION.
JDK 5 –ல் இருந்து OBJECT –களின் தொகுப்பில் இருந்து டேட்டா அணுகும் போது
(உதாரணம்:ARRAY)
FOR LOOP-ல் மாற்றம்
செய்யப்பட்டுள்ளது.
SYNTAX:
for(type itr-var : collection)
statement-block
type
ஆனது டேட்டா இனத்தையும் itr-varஎன்பது itreration variable-யையும்
குறிக்கின்றது.. collection என்பது arrayபோன்றவற்றின் பெயரையும் குறிக்கின்றது.
உதாரணம்
nums என்ற
அர்ரேவிலிருந்து x என்ற பெயரில் ஒவ்வொரு தடவையும் ஒவ்வொரு உறுப்பாக அணுகப்படுகின்றது.
நான் மதுரையில் C,C++,JAVA CLASSES நடத்தி வருகின்றேன்.
மேலும் DOTNET,PHP,TALLY,MS-OFFICE
வகுப்புகளும் நடத்தி வருகின்றேன்.
தொடர்புக்கு:
91
96293 29142
No comments:
Post a Comment